Profile

Vitaliy Mezhuyev received a specialist degree in informatics from Berdyansk State Pedagogical University (BSPU), Ukraine, in 1997. In 2002, he received a PhD in Educational Technology from Kyiv National Pedagogical University and, in 2012, an ScD (habilitation) in Information Technology from Odesa National Technical University, Ukraine. From 2004 until 2014, he was the Head of the Department of Informatics and Software Engineering at BSPU, Ukraine. From 2014 until 2019 he was a Professor at the Faculty of Computer Systems and Software Engineering at the University Malaysia Pahang, Head of the Software Engineering Research Group. Now he is a Professor at the Institute of Industrial Management in FH JOANNEUM University of Applied Sciences, Austria. During his career, Vitaliy Mezhuyev participated in multiple international scientific and industrial projects, devoted to the formal modeling, design, and development of advanced software systems as a network-centric real-time operating system; IDEs for the automation of development of parallel real-time applications; tools for specification, verification and validation of software products; visual environment for metamaterials modeling and others. His current research interests include formal methods, metamodeling, safety modeling and verification of software systems, IoT, and the design of cyber-physical systems.
